What is the lessee is authorized to use the abovedescribed horse for showing and recreational purposes only
The form titled "Lessee Is Authorized To Use The Abovedescribed Horse For Showing And Recreational Purposes Only" serves as a legal agreement between the horse owner and the lessee. This document outlines the specific permissions granted to the lessee regarding the use of the horse. The primary focus is on allowing the lessee to engage in showing and recreational activities, ensuring that both parties understand the limitations and responsibilities involved in the arrangement.
Key elements of the lessee is authorized to use the abovedescribed horse for showing and recreational purposes only
Several critical components must be included in this form to ensure its effectiveness and legality. These elements typically encompass:
- Identification of the parties: Clearly state the names and contact information of both the horse owner and the lessee.
- Description of the horse: Provide specific details about the horse, including breed, age, and any identifying marks.
- Usage limitations: Clearly outline that the horse is to be used solely for showing and recreational purposes, prohibiting other uses such as breeding or commercial activities.
- Duration of the agreement: Specify the time frame during which the lessee is authorized to use the horse.
- Liability and insurance: Include clauses that address liability for injuries or damages that may occur during the use of the horse.

Legal use of the lessee is authorized to use the abovedescribed horse for showing and recreational purposes only
To ensure the legal validity of the form, it must comply with relevant laws and regulations regarding equine leasing agreements. This includes adherence to local and state laws governing animal use and leasing practices. The lessee should ensure that the form is signed by both parties, and it may be beneficial to have it notarized to further establish its authenticity and enforceability in a legal context.
